 Abstract: Pseudomonas fluorescens F113 is a plant growth-promoting rhizobacterium (PGPR) that has biocontrol activity against fungal
plant pathogens and is a model for rhizosphere colonization. Here, we present its complete genome sequence, which shows that
besides a core genome very similar to those of other strains sequenced within this species, F113 possesses a wide array of genes
encoding specialized functions for thriving in the rhizosphere and interacting with eukaryotic organisms.
